Transaction 626ff56734126a78e02ba750da5a2603cd10023e46bbb3f417d21c25f5746ad6
1 Input
1 Output
-
626ff56734126a78e02ba750da5a2603cd10023e46bbb3f417d21c25f5746ad6:0
- value
- 866795
- script pubkey
- OP_0 OP_PUSHBYTES_20 22302fe6c9a3320877bd8672b60e973cf14e9cff
- address
- bc1qygczlekf5veqsaaaseetvr5h8nc5a88lfegxch